Hundreds of students and financial aid supporters from Gustavus Adolphus College and other Minnesota private colleges and universities will gather at the state Capitol this spring to advocate for need-based student financial aid. Gustavus’ Day at the Capitol will be shared with Macalester College and is scheduled for Thursday, March 6.

Day at the Capitol is produced by the Minnesota Private College Council (MPCC) and allows students to learn how to become effective advocates while urging state legislators to support Minnesota students. Currently more than 71,000 Minnesota undergraduate students receive need-based aid through the State Grant Program. The average State Grant award is currently $1,748.

“The amount of student debt has grown 162 percent since 1995, and each year Minnesota students and their families have to borrow more than a billion dollars to cover the costs of higher education,” Gustavus junior and Student Senate Co-President Anthony Spain said. “That’s why we go to the Capitol every year — to ask our legislators to relieve the burden of increasing tuition costs on Minnesota families.”
